How can companies adapt their customer experience training programs to address any emerging trends or changes in customer preferences to ensure continued success in enhancing customer satisfaction levels?
Companies can adapt their customer experience training programs by staying informed about emerging trends and changes in customer preferences through market research and customer feedback. They should regularly update their training materials and techniques to incorporate new technologies and communication channels that customers prefer. Companies can also focus on providing personalized and proactive customer service to meet individual needs and expectations. By continuously evaluating and adjusting their training programs based on customer insights, companies can ensure they are meeting evolving customer preferences and ultimately enhance customer satisfaction levels.
